在现代软件开发中,GitHub已经成为了一个不可或缺的平台。无论是开源项目还是私有项目,开发者们都喜欢使用GitHub进行版本控制和协作。本文将为大家详细介绍如何在Ubuntu系统上从GitHub下载文件,并解答一些常见问题。
目录
什么是GitHub?
GitHub是一个代码托管平台,开发者可以在上面共享和管理代码。它使用Git作为版本控制系统,使得代码的管理更加方便。用户可以通过创建仓库来存放项目,支持多人协作,能够进行问题追踪、项目管理等多种功能。
为什么要在Ubuntu上下载GitHub文件?
在Ubuntu上下载GitHub文件的原因有很多,主要包括:
- 开源项目:许多开源项目都在GitHub上托管,开发者可以直接下载并进行修改。
- 学习资源:GitHub上有大量的学习资源和示例代码,方便初学者学习。
- 项目贡献:如果你想为某个项目贡献代码,首先需要将代码下载到本地进行修改。
使用命令行下载GitHub文件
在Ubuntu中,使用命令行下载GitHub文件是非常高效的,主要有两种常见方法:使用git命令和wget命令。
使用git命令
-
安装Git:在终端中输入以下命令来安装Git:
bash
sudo apt update
sudo apt install git -
克隆仓库:使用以下命令克隆整个仓库:
bash
git clone https://github.com/用户名/仓库名.git例如:
bash
git clone https://github.com/octocat/Hello-World.git
使用wget命令
-
安装wget:在终端中输入以下命令安装wget:
bash
sudo apt install wget -
下载文件:可以直接通过wget下载文件:
bash
wget https://raw.githubusercontent.com/用户名/仓库名/分支名/文件路径例如:
bash
wget https://raw.githubusercontent.com/octocat/Hello-World/main/README.md
使用图形界面下载GitHub文件
如果你不喜欢使用命令行,Ubuntu也提供了图形界面下载GitHub文件的方式:
- 打开浏览器,访问你想要下载的GitHub项目页面。
- 找到“Code”按钮,点击后选择“Download ZIP”。
- 下载完成后,解压缩ZIP文件,即可查看文件内容。
下载特定文件或文件夹
如果你只想下载特定的文件或文件夹,而不是整个仓库,可以使用以下方法:
- 访问GitHub项目页面,找到特定文件,点击右上角的“Raw”按钮。
- 右键点击页面,选择“另存为”进行下载。
- 对于文件夹,建议使用git命令克隆整个项目后手动删除不需要的部分,GitHub本身不支持单独下载文件夹。
常见问题解答
如何在Ubuntu上安装Git?
你可以使用以下命令在Ubuntu上安装Git:
bash
sudo apt update
sudo apt install git
我可以只下载GitHub上的某个文件吗?
是的,你可以通过访问该文件的Raw链接并选择“另存为”来下载特定文件。
如何查看下载的文件内容?
下载完成后,你可以使用文本编辑器(如gedit)打开文件,命令如下:
bash
gedit 文件名
如果遇到下载失败,应该怎么办?
请检查网络连接,确保GitHub网站没有问题。如果是使用命令行下载,可以查看错误信息并进行相应调整。
如何更新已下载的GitHub项目?
在已克隆的项目目录中,使用以下命令更新项目:
bash
git pull
以上就是在Ubuntu上从GitHub下载文件的详细步骤和常见问题解答,希望对大家有所帮助!